Actions for running CodeQL analysis
Role in this project:
Back-end Developer & Automation Engineer Contributions:65 reviews, 41 commits, 49 PRs in 2 years 4 months
Contributions summary:Nick primarily contributed to the development of the `exec_wrapper` function, which enhances the execution of commands within the CodeQL action. Their work involved implementing features for handling stdout and stderr, including custom listeners and error matching using regular expressions. The user also refactored the `exec_wrapper` to better manage return values and handle error scenarios more effectively, ensuring robust command execution within the CodeQL environment. Furthermore, they added unit tests for the `exec_wrapper` to ensure the intended behavior.
code-scanningsemmle-qladvanced-securitycodeqlci
Accelerating new GitHub Actions workflows
Role in this project:
DevOps Engineer & Automation Engineer Contributions:107 reviews, 107 commits, 74 PRs in 1 year 11 months
Contributions summary:Nick focused on improving the workflow and validation processes within the repository. They implemented checks related to GitHub Enterprise Server (GHES) compatibility, specifically targeting YAML files and action names. Their contributions involved modifying scripts to validate code-scanning workflows and enhance the criteria for workflow validation, including checking file extensions and allowed categories. Further, the user contributed to integrating partner workflows.
continuous-testingci-cdcontinuous-integrationworkflowsworkflow